Funny, how dominant political parties tend to tar their
marginalized opponents as "traitors" and
"terrorists." Actually, it's not funny at all. Here's California
State Assembly Speaker Karen Bass having a
friendly conversation with L.A. Times columnist Patt
Morrison:
How do you think conservative talk radio has affected the Legislature's work?
The Republicans were essentially threatened and terrorized against voting for revenue. Now [some] are facing recalls. They operate under a terrorist threat: "You vote for revenue and your career is over." I don't know why we allow that kind of terrorism to exist. I guess it's about free speech, but it's extremely unfair.
Hat tip to (the properly outraged) Chris Reed.
